Highest runs scored in the last 10 overs in T20I history
India's 160 runs in the final 10 overs against Zimbabwe broke Sri Lanka's 17-year-old record in T20Is

1. India vs Zimbabwe, 2024 – 160 runs
Thanks to Abhishek Sharma’s maiden ton and great knocks from both Ruturaj Gaikwad and Rinku Singh by the end of the innings saw India post a mammoth total of 234 in the second T20I of their 5-match T20I series against Zimbabwe in Harare.

2. Sri Lanka vs Kenya, 2007 – 159 runs
After brilliant knocks from Sanath Jayasuriya and Mahela Jayawardene, Jehan Mubarak’s 46 runs off just 13 balls powered Sri Lanka to a huge total of 260. The match took place in Johannesburg in the T20 World Cup 2007.

3. Afghanistan vs Ireland, 2019 – 156 runs
Hazratullah Zazai’s incredible knock of 162 carried Afghanistan to a massive total of 278 against Ireland in Dehradun.

4. New Zealand vs West Indies, 2020 – 154 runs
Glenn Phillips and Devon Conway’s massive 184-run stand took the Black Caps to a huge total of 238 against West Indies at Mount Maunganui.
